Killeen ISD Is Hiring Teachers!

 Killeen Independent School District is looking for new professionals to join their team! The school district is the 4th most diverse in the state of Texas. Serving the cities of Killeen, Fort Hood, Harker Heights and Nolanville, and jobs are available throughout the schools. KISD has over 50 campuses, employs over 6,100 individuals, and educates over 45,000 children.

Why Work At Killeen ISD?

Teacher salaries start at $52,000 per year. Bilingual and special education instructors are eligible for competitive stipends. Additional stipends are available. The District offers health, dental, disability, and life insurance. The employees enjoy week-long Spring Break, week-long Thanksgiving break, and a two-week long Christmas break. Teachers can earn additional income by teaching Summer School.  

Central Texas residents enjoy a low cost of living and no state income tax. The community is diverse, fast-growing and has a variety of family-friendly activities available. 

Benefits Of Working At Killeen ISD

Teachers are offered free professional development opportunities, 1-on-1 teacher mentorship program, classroom teacher supply annual supplemental pay, and access to a Teacher Media Center. In addition to insurance, KISD has an Employee Assistance Program (EAP). This program assists employees with a range of needs, both personal and professional. Resources for mental health, finance, legal, and more are available through this program.

The steps to become a certified teacher at Killeen ISD are:

  • Obtain a bachelor’s degree from an accredited college/university
  • Complete an Educator Preparation Program (Current employees can take advantage of the Alternative Certification reimbursement stipend, up to $5,000)
  • Pass the appropriate teacher certification exams
  • Submit an application to the State
  • If you are a first-time applicant, complete fingerprinting requirements
